3 Key Water Quality Standards
1. ASTM D5127-13
• Resistivity: 18.2MΩ·cm
• TOC: <5ppb
2. SEMI F63
• Particles: <5/ml (>0.1μm)
• Silica: <1ppb
3. JIS H 0605
• Ionic contamination: <0.1μg/cm²

EDI Technology Explained
How It Works
1. Ion exchange membranes separate charged particles
2. DC current drives continuous regeneration
3. Pure water exits through central manifold
Benefits vs Mixed Bed
✔ No chemical regeneration
✔ 24/7 continuous operation
✔ 50% lower operating costs
